Enable job alerts via email!
A global banking and financial services corporation is seeking a Software Engineer to work on their Equities Smart Order Router. The role involves driving the full software development life cycle while collaborating globally with various stakeholders. Ideal candidates have strong Java skills and a background in financial technology. The position offers a hybrid working model and competitive benefits including 27 days annual leave and a discretionary performance-related bonus.
Overview
Citi is a world-leading global bank. We have approximately 200 million customer accounts and a presence in more than 160 countries and jurisdictions worldwide. We provide consumers, corporations, governments, and institutions with a broad range of financial products and services, including consumer banking and credit, corporate and investment banking, securities brokerage, transaction services, and wealth management. We enable clients to achieve their strategic financial objectives by providing them with cutting-edge ideas, best-in-class products and solutions, and unparalleled access to capital and liquidity.
What We do / The Team
Join Citi's Equities Smart Order Router team, a core part of our Front Office Technology, driving innovation in electronic trading. This established team builds and maintains high-performance, low-latency, high-throughput applications vital for optimizing liquidity sourcing across global markets.
You will provide end-to-end SDLC support, developing and enhancing critical trading components. This involves close collaboration with Product teams on requirements, Quants for algorithm implementation, and Production Support to ensure platform stability.
Our team thrives on solving complex challenges at the intersection of high-performance computing and intricate trading strategies. If you're passionate about building cutting-edge financial technology with direct market impact, this role offers an exciting opportunity within a highly collaborative and impactful environment.
Role Overview/What will you do:
Key Skills and Experience required:
We are seeking a highly skilled and experienced software engineer with a strong background in financial technology. The ideal candidate will possess:
Any Beneficial / Nice to have skills and experience:
What we’ll provide you
By joining Citi London, you will not only be part of a business casual workplace with a hybrid working model (up to 2 days working at home per week), but also receive a competitive base salary (which is annually reviewed), and enjoy a whole host of additional benefits such as:
Visit ourGlobal Benefitspage to learn more.
Alongside these benefits Citi is committed to ensuring our workplace is where everyone feels comfortable coming to work as their whole self, every day. We want the best talent around the world to be energized to join us, motivated to stay and empowered to thrive.
------------------------------------------------------
Job Family Group:
Technology------------------------------------------------------
Job Family:
Applications Development------------------------------------------------------
Time Type:
Full time------------------------------------------------------
Most Relevant Skills
Please see the requirements listed above.------------------------------------------------------
Other Relevant Skills
For complementary skills, please see above and/or contact the recruiter.------------------------------------------------------
Citi is an equal opportunity employer, and qualified candidates will receive consideration without regard to their race, color, religion, sex, sexual orientation, gender identity, national origin, disability, status as a protected veteran, or any other characteristic protected by law.
If you are a person with a disability and need a reasonable accommodation to use our search tools and/or apply for a career opportunity review Accessibility at Citi.
View Citi’s EEO Policy Statement and the Know Your Rights poster.